Responsibilities
- Supporting the global Sales Org in deal execution on a daily basis
- Provide guidance and support on contract negotiations internally, including: deal structure, discounting guidance, order processing, etc
- Drive process and systems requirements (including CPQ) to implement best-in-class quote-to-order process; provide assistance is closing/managing deals in the systems
- Evaluation and review of all contracts for completeness, accuracy, and adherence to our policies
- Ensure approvals for non-standard deals have been properly documented, escalated to the right approval levels, and resolved within reasonable timeframe
- Drive best practices and enablement to increase sales effectiveness via structured deal reviews and checkpoints, supported by standard business practices and policies, and proper enablement around these
- Work independently on projects, and apply judgment in resolving issues or in making recommendations
- Develop strong collaborative relationships with key stakeholders in Sales, Legal, Finance, Accounting, and other key teams across the company
- Assisting in other general Sales Operations projects and initiatives
